How to Use Taiyi Stones
Taiyi Stones are used to reforge certain gold-tier weapon skins to alter their appearances for cosmetic purposes. Learn more about how to use Taiyi Stones and where to get them here in this guide.

What Are Taiyi Stones?

Currency for Reforging Weapon Skins from the Draw Shop

Taiyi Stones are special currency used to reforge gold-tier weapon skins purchased from the Draw Shop. Reforging is the process of changing the appearance of the weapon skin without actually improving on the weapon's stats.

Meaning to say, Taiyi Stones are only used for cosmetic purposes and have no bearing on your build's offensive capabilities. To improve your build's stats, you need to tune your gear instead.

How to Use Taiyi Stones

  1. Get the Weapon Skin from the Draw Shop First
  2. Spend Taiyi Stones to Fill Up Reforging Meter
  3. Spend Taiyi Stones to Reroll for Set Appearance

1. Get the Weapon Skin from the Draw Shop First

Weapon Skins in Draw Shop
You first need to acquire the base appearance of a weapon skin from the Draw Shop before you can reforge it. To purchase a weapon skin, you need 1 Harmonic Core, which you obtain by spending more than 131 Lingering Echoes in the Celestial Echo draw.

Note that you only purchase the base appearance as you need to reforge it to create its unique appearance. Additionally, reforging is only available for some gold-tier weapon skins.

2. Spend Taiyi Stones to Fill Up Reforging Meter

Go to your character's Appearance menu and scroll to the Weapons tab to access the weapon skin. After selecting Reforge, you will be taken to a screen where you need to fill up a meter with five notches to obtain a random skin for each part of the weapon. This is where you need to spend Taiyi Stones to fill up the meter.

It takes about 120 Taiyi Stones to fully unlock all notches, so you need to spend about 30 Taiyi Stones to unlock each one.

Every Weapon Skin Has Color and Bright Light Notches

The second, third, and fourth notches of a weapon skin correspond with the different parts of a weapon, such as the sword's hilt or a spear's shaft. While the names of the parts vary depending on the weapon, all weapons share the first Color and fifth Bright Light notches.

Both these notches give color to the weapon skin and the aura surrounding it. Like with the other notches, the colors are randomized.

3. Spend Taiyi Stones to Reroll for Set Appearance

Weapon Skin Set Previews
If you check the preview for a weapon skin in the Draw Shop, you will see that there are different variations of a weapon skin you can get. Because obtaining each skin part for the weapon is randomized, it is highly likely that you will opt to reroll to get your preferred set appearance.

In this case, you need to accumulate more Taiyi Stones again until you are satisfied with the outcome of the weapon skin. Otherwise, you can keep your weapon skin as it is without adhering to a set appearance.

Lock a Notch to Save the Skin You Want

If you manage to obtain the skin you want for a weapon part, you can lock its notch to save its appearance as you roll for the skins in the other notches. You should note that locking a notch increases the cost of Taiyi Stones the next time you hit the reforge button.

Keep Track of Skins in the Saved Optimal Plan Panel

The reforging menu has a Saved Optimal Plan panel that autosaves your five most optimal plans based on the highest number of Elegance Points. It is highly recommended to refer to this panel to monitor the skins you want to keep on your weapon as you roll. This way, you minimize overspending as switching between plans does not reset the meter's progress.

You can also choose to manually save your plan of choice, but you are only reserved one save to do this. Otherwise, you have to overwrite your plan with the new one.

How to Get Taiyi Stones

Purchase for 200 Echo Beads in the Shop

Purchase Taiyi Stone for 200 Echo Beads
Taiyi Stones can be purchased from the Shop under Items for 200 Echo Beads. This is the fastest way of accumulating Taiyi Stones as you can purchase as many as you want with the game's top-up system and reforge your weapon skin as soon as possible.

How to Top Up

Purchase for 45 Essence of Heaven in the Draw Shop

Purchase Taiyi Stone for 45 Essence of Heaven
Alternatively, you can buy Taiyi Stones for 45 Essence of Heaven from the Draw Shop. To earn Essences of Heaven, you need to draw from the Celestial Echo gacha, where you earn 1 Essence of Heaven per pull. In turn, you need to accumulate as many Lingering Echoes as you can to make several pulls.

This is the most tedious method of purchasing Taiyi Stones if you choose to save Lingering Echoes without topping up.
